Meaning of "common time"
common time - This phrase is a musical term that refers to a specific time signature used in Western music, also known as 4/4 time. It is the most commonly used time signature and indicates four beats per measure
Show more definitions
- A meter of four quarter notes per measure.
- The ordinary pace of marching, in which ninety steps, each twenty-eight inches in length, are taken in one minute.
